其他分享
首页 > 其他分享> > android – 如何播放存储在在线文件服务器上的视频?

android – 如何播放存储在在线文件服务器上的视频?

作者:互联网

我必须在我的Android应用程序中播放视频.该文件存储在在线文件服务器上

链接是:http://view.vzaar.com/923037/video

我无法使用VideoView播放此文件.我还尝试将此文件加载到WebView中,但WebView打开Web浏览器,然后文件开始播放.

有没有办法直接将这些文件播放到我的应用程序而无需下载到设备?

解决方法:

对于您的VideoView,prpoblem使用setVideoPath方法.您需要使用setVideoURI来指定流式源:

VideoView mVideoView = (VideoView) findViewById(R.id.vdoTest);
mVideoView.setMediaController(new MediaController(this));
String viewSource ="http://view.vzaar.com/923037/video";
mVideoView.setVideoURI(Uri.parse(viewSource));

如果视频编码正确,这应该可行:(AAC H.264,基线)

标签:android,video-streaming,videoview,android-video-player
来源: https://codeday.me/bug/20190609/1208351.html